Resources on Tap: What Can Partners Bring?

So, what exactly do these local organizations offer? Well, for starters:

  • Funding and Grants: Many local organizations have financial resources earmarked for community health projects. HOSA can leverage these to enhance its initiatives.

  • Volunteers: Imagine the enthusiasm of local volunteers who are passionate about health—who wouldn’t want that on their team?

  • Networking Opportunities: Partnerships can open doors to a broader network, allowing HOSA members to connect with mentors and industry leaders.

By pooling these resources, HOSA can transform its projects from good to great. Community partners can provide the kind of holistic support that ensures projects don't just occur in isolation but resonate deeply within the community.

The Pitfalls of Lackluster Partnerships

On the flip side, let’s take a moment to consider what not to do. Some might think increasing competition among organizations could spur creativity. But in reality, competition can lead to tension and disarray. Instead of collaborating, groups might find themselves working against each other, which undermines the primary goal of community health betterment.

Similarly, sticking to a single point of view tends to stifle innovation. Picture this: you’re in a brainstorming session, and one person’s idea dominates. Without diverse opinions and approaches, the outcome can be bland at best.

And then there's the trap of limiting outreach to specific demographics. Sure, some initiatives might target certain groups, but this exclusion could leave vital segments of the community without necessary resources or support. A community project should aim to uplift everyone—after all, community health impacts all of us.
